Scientific summary

Evernic acid is isolated from Evernia prunastri, collected and voucher-determined in Slovakia. It was characterised by NMR and tested in DPPH and superoxide anion scavenging assays in our 2022 comparative study, and included in the 2023 multi-compound screening panel.

Commercial positioning

Of the compounds in this line, evernic acid has the clearest fit with cosmetic and nutraceutical discovery programmes: a well-defined natural source, a documented isolation route, and antioxidant data generated in the same laboratory as the rest of the panel, so cross-compound comparison is internally consistent.

Specification

Compound classDidepside (lichen secondary metabolite)
Biological sourceEvernia prunastri
Evidence statusPublished evidence (in vitro), two independent studies
PublicationsElečko J et al., Plants 2022;11(8):1077 · Kello M et al., Plants 2023;12(3):611
Typical pilotBioactivity pilot 4–8 weeks
